Patent number: 9555458Abstract: An ironing ring for use in a press for ironing pressing or drawing of a workpiece. The ironing ring has a work surface which, upon deforming the workpiece, contacts the workpiece, and causes flowing of the workpiece material. In order to prevent friction deposits in the region of the work surface of the ironing ring, a microstructure, differing from the roughness of the work surface, is introduced into the work surface, which forms elevations and/or recesses in the work surface. Material particles remaining on the work surface after the deforming of a workpiece thus adhere less strongly to the work surface and can be stripped off during the next deforming process.Type: GrantFiled: September 11, 2015Date of Patent: January 31, 2017Assignee: SCHULER PRESSEN GMBHInventor: Klaus Blei

Patent number: 9555467Abstract: Amorphous steel composites with enhanced mechanical properties and related methods for toughening amorphous steel alloys. The composites are formed from monolithic amorphous steel and hard ceramic particulates, which must be embedded in the glass matrix through melting at a temperature above the melting point for the steel but below the melting point for the ceramic. The ceramics may be carbides, nitrides, borides, iron-refractory carbides, or iron-refractory borides. The produced composites may be one of two types, primarily distinguished by the methods for embedding the ceramic particulates in the steel. These methods may be applied to a variety of amorphous steels as well as other non-ferrous amorphous metals, and the resulting composites can be used in various applications and utilizations.Type: GrantFiled: May 18, 2015Date of Patent: January 31, 2017Assignee: University of Virginia Patent FoundationInventors: S. Patent number: 9555469Abstract: An aluminum alloy casting free from crack-causing needle-shaped crystallized substances, and an apparatus and a method for producing a slide member excellent in mechanical properties such as abrasion resistance are provided. A melt of an iron-containing aluminum alloy poured into a vessel in the completely liquid state is vibrated by a vibrating needle of a vibration applying unit, and then a core is inserted into the melt to cool the melt, whereby the aluminum alloy casting is produced as a sleeve of a slide member. The vibrating step is carried out at a frequency of 20 to 1000 Hz, and is continued until just before the melt is cooled to the solid-liquid coexisting temperature region.Type: GrantFiled: June 26, 2013Date of Patent: January 31, 2017Assignee: HONDA MOTOR CO., LTD.Inventors: Takashi Idegomori, Akio Shimoda

Patent number: 9555491Abstract: Elevation mechanisms for table saws and anti-backdrive mechanisms for use in elevation mechanisms for table saws are disclosed. The anti-backdrive mechanisms typically include three sub-assemblies: an input assembly, an output assembly, and a fixed assembly. The anti-backdrive mechanisms prevent a torque related to the output assembly from changing the blade elevation. For example, the weight of the blade and the structure supporting the blade is prevented from backdriving the elevation mechanism and allowing the blade to drop.Type: GrantFiled: July 19, 2013Date of Patent: January 31, 2017Assignee: SD3, LLCInventors: Stephen F.
